Dunlap Memorial Fellowship awarded by the William Morris Society in the  United States supports scholarly and creative work about William Morris. The fellowship  offers funding up to $1000 for research and other expenses, including travel to conferences and   libraries. Projects may deal with any subject biographical, literary, historical, social, artistic, political, typographical—relating to Morris.  The Society also encourages translations of Morris's   works and the production of teaching materials (lesson plans and course materials) suitable  for use at the elementary, secondary, college or adult education level.  Applications are sought  particularly from younger members of the Society and from those at the beginning of their  careers.
